An 1837 Pattern Rifle Officer's Presentation Sword
By Pulford & Sons, 65 St. James's Street, London SW1, Dated 1926

With bright tapering fullered blade etched with symmetrical designs of foliated strapwork over half its length on each side, one side with crowned 'GRV' cypher, and on the other with crowned vacant cartouche, slug bugle horn and the presentation inscription, nickel-plated gothic hilt incorporating slug bugle horn within a laurel wreath and complete with its black leather sword-knot, and wire-bound fishskin-covered grip, in its nickel-plated scabbard with two rings for suspension, and in fine condition
83 cm. blade

Footnotes

Provenance:
Bonhams Oxford, The Gary Bates Collection of Swords & Militaria, Part II, 5 December 2012, lot 225

The presentation inscription reads: 'Presented To R.S.M. S.E. Ings. By The W.O.'s, And Sergts. Of The Rifle Depot, 28.6.1926
